Collins
ancient ★★★☆☆
/e͟ɪnʃənt/
1
[ADJ-GRADED 能被表示程度的副词或介词词组修饰的形容词]远古的;古代的 Ancient means belonging to the distant past, especially to the period in history before the end of the Roman Empire.
  [ADJ n]
  • They believed ancient Greece and Rome were vital sources of learning.

    他们认为古代希腊罗马是知识的重要发源地。

anciently
  • Salisbury Plain was known anciently as Ellendune.

    索尔兹伯里平原在古代被称为Ellendune。

2
[ADJ-GRADED 能被表示程度的副词或介词词组修饰的形容词]古老的;年代久远的 Ancient means very old, or having existed for a long time.
  [usu ADJ n]
  • ...ancient Jewish tradition.

    古老的犹太传统

  • ...ancient fishing rights.

    由来已久的捕鱼权

  • ...a few acres of ancient woodland.

    几英亩古老的林地

3
[N-PLURAL 复数名词]古代人;(尤指)古希腊人,古罗马人 The ancients are the people of an old civilization, especially classical Greece or Rome.
  [the N]
  • The ancients knew more than we do about the heavens.

    古代人对于上天比我们知道得多。

ancientan‧cient1 /ˈeɪnʃənt/ ●●● W2 adjective
Word Origin
Examples
Thesaurus
Collocations
Phrases
1belonging to a time long ago in history, especially thousands of years ago OPP  modern:  the ancient civilizations of Asiaancient Greece/Egypt/Rome the religion of ancient Egypt2having existed for a very long time OPP  new:  an ancient walled city an ancient forest the ancient art of calligraphy3very old – used humorously:  That photo makes me look ancient! see thesaurus at
old
4ancient history a)the history of ancient societies, such as Greece or Rome:  a professor of ancient history b)informal if you say that something is ancient history, you mean that it happened a long time ago and is not important now:  It’s all ancient history and I’m not upset anymore.
